a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--keyboards/ergodox/keymaps/333fred/README.md18
-rw-r--r--keyboards/ergodox/keymaps/333fred/keymap.c2
2 files changed, 13 insertions, 7 deletions
diff --git a/keyboards/ergodox/keymaps/333fred/README.md b/keyboards/ergodox/keymaps/333fred/README.md
index 7d40f92c5..af8042d85 100644
--- a/keyboards/ergodox/keymaps/333fred/README.md
+++ b/keyboards/ergodox/keymaps/333fred/README.md
@@ -21,7 +21,8 @@
21 | | | Del | |OSL(2)| | | 21 | | | Del | |OSL(2)| | |
22 `--------------------' `----------------------' 22 `--------------------' `----------------------'
23``` 23```
24 24* Double-click `;` to get a `:`
25* Press-and-hold `f` to go to the movement layer
25 26
26### Keymap 1: Code Layer 27### Keymap 1: Code Layer
27``` 28```
@@ -37,13 +38,14 @@
37 | | | | | | | | | | | | 38 | | | | | | | | | | | |
38 `----------------------------------' `----------------------------------' 39 `----------------------------------' `----------------------------------'
39 ,-------------. ,---------------. 40 ,-------------. ,---------------.
40 | | | | Test | DTest | 41 |Format| | | Test | DTest |
41 ,------|------|------| |------+--------+------. 42 ,------|------|------| |------+--------+------.
42 | | |Refact| | | | | 43 | | |Refact| | | | |
43 | | |------| |------| | | 44 | | |------| |------| | |
44 | | | | | | | | 45 | | | | | | | |
45 `--------------------' `----------------------' 46 `--------------------' `----------------------'
46``` 47```
48* Format - Visual Studio Format. Sends `CTRL + K, CTRL + D`
47* Refact - Visual Studio Refactor. Sends `CTRL + R, R` 49* Refact - Visual Studio Refactor. Sends `CTRL + R, R`
48* Test - Visual Studio Run Test. Sends `CTRL + R, T` 50* Test - Visual Studio Run Test. Sends `CTRL + R, T`
49* DTest - Visual Studio Debug Test. Sends `CTRL + R, CTRL + T` 51* DTest - Visual Studio Debug Test. Sends `CTRL + R, CTRL + T`
@@ -64,11 +66,12 @@
64 ,-------------. ,-------------. 66 ,-------------. ,-------------.
65 | | Caps | | | | 67 | | Caps | | | |
66 ,------|------|------| |------+------+------. 68 ,------|------|------| |------+------+------.
67 | | | | | | | | 69 | | |APscr | | | | |
68 | | |------| |------| | | 70 | | |------| |------| | |
69 | | | PScr | | | | | 71 | | | PScr | | | | |
70 `--------------------' `--------------------' 72 `--------------------' `--------------------'
71``` 73```
74* APscr - Take a printscreen of the current app. Sends `Alt + Print Screen`
72 75
73### Keymap 3: Media and Mouse Keys 76### Keymap 3: Media and Mouse Keys
74``` 77```
@@ -99,9 +102,9 @@
99|--------+------+------+------+------+-------------| |------+------+------+------+------+------+--------| 102|--------+------+------+------+------+-------------| |------+------+------+------+------+------+--------|
100| | | | | | | | | | | | | | | | 103| | | | | | | | | | | | | | | |
101|--------+------+------+------+------+------| | | |------+------+------+------+------+--------| 104|--------+------+------+------+------+------| | | |------+------+------+------+------+--------|
102| | | |LShift| | |------| |------| Left | Down | Up | Right| | | 105| |DLeft |DRight|LShift| | |------| |------| Left | Down | Up | Right| | |
103|--------+------+------+------+------+------| | | |------+------+------+------+------+--------| 106|--------+------+------+------+------+------| | | |------+------+------+------+------+--------|
104| | | | | | | | | | | | | | | | 107| |KOpen |KType | | | | | | | | | | | | |
105`--------+------+------+------+------+-------------' `-------------+------+------+------+------+--------' 108`--------+------+------+------+------+-------------' `-------------+------+------+------+------+--------'
106 | | | | | | | | | | | | 109 | | | | | | | | | | | |
107 `----------------------------------' `----------------------------------' 110 `----------------------------------' `----------------------------------'
@@ -113,4 +116,7 @@
113 | | | | | | | | 116 | | | | | | | |
114 `--------------------' `--------------------' 117 `--------------------' `--------------------'
115``` 118```
116 \ No newline at end of file 119* DLeft - Move to the left Desktop. Sends `Ctrl + Win + Left Arrow`
120* DRight - Move to the right Desktop. Sends `Ctrl + Win + Right Arrow`
121* KOpen - Opens KeePass. Sends `Ctrl + Alt + k`
122* KType - Autotypes KeePass password. Sends `Ctrl + Alt + a`
diff --git a/keyboards/ergodox/keymaps/333fred/keymap.c b/keyboards/ergodox/keymaps/333fred/keymap.c
index a63c9704f..070ad1f72 100644
--- a/keyboards/ergodox/keymaps/333fred/keymap.c
+++ b/keyboards/ergodox/keymaps/333fred/keymap.c
@@ -289,7 +289,7 @@ const macro_t *action_get_macro(keyrecord_t *record, uint8_t id, uint8_t opt)
289 return MACRO(D(LCTL), D(LGUI), T(RIGHT), U(LGUI), U(LCTL), END); 289 return MACRO(D(LCTL), D(LGUI), T(RIGHT), U(LGUI), U(LCTL), END);
290 } 290 }
291 break; 291 break;
292 case PSCREEN_APP; 292 case PSCREEN_APP:
293 if (record->event.pressed) { 293 if (record->event.pressed) {
294 return MACRO(D(LALT), T(PSCR), U(LALT)); 294 return MACRO(D(LALT), T(PSCR), U(LALT));
295 } 295 }